Altair Acquires S-FRAME Software
August 10, 2021
Altair (Nasdaq: ALTR) has acquired S-FRAME Software, a British Columbia–based structural analysis and design software company founded in 1981, to strengthen Altair's presence in the Architecture, Engineering and Construction (AEC) market. The acquisition combines S-FRAME's finite element and code-compliance capabilities with Altair's simulation, HPC and optimization platform, and S-FRAME products will be offered via Altair Units subscription licensing.

Altair Acquires Research in Flight (FlightStream)
May 1, 2024
Software
Altair has acquired Research in Flight, the developer of FlightStream — a fast, low-footprint computational fluid dynamics (CFD) solver used heavily in aerospace and defense and increasingly in marine, energy, turbomachinery, and automotive markets. The technology will be integrated into Altair’s HyperWorks platform and made available via Altair Units to expand Altair’s aerodynamic simulation capabilities for customers including aerospace, defense, and advanced mobility sectors.

Siemens Industry Software Acquires Altair Engineering
March 26, 2025
AI & Machine Learning
Siemens has signed an agreement to acquire Altair Engineering Inc. for $113 per share in cash, valuing the deal at about USD 10 billion. The transaction will combine Altair’s simulation, HPC, data science and AI capabilities with Siemens Xcelerator to create a more comprehensive AI-powered industrial software and digital twin portfolio.

Altair Acquires OmniQuest
October 2, 2023
Software
Altair (Nasdaq: ALTR) acquired OmniQuest, a Novi, Michigan-based developer of Genesis, an advanced structural optimization and finite-element analysis software. The deal adds OmniQuest's optimization algorithms and expertise—used across automotive, motorsport (Formula 1) and aerospace applications—to Altair's simulation and AI product portfolio to strengthen its optimization capabilities.

Rocscience Acquires Italian Structural Engineering Software Provider 2SI
July 16, 2025
Software
Rocscience, a Toronto-based developer of geotechnical engineering software, has acquired 2SI, an Italy-based provider of structural engineering and FEA software. The acquisition expands Rocscience's product portfolio and integrates 2SI's structural-engineering expertise to strengthen capabilities for civil, infrastructure, and construction markets.

Builders FirstSource Acquires California TrusFrame
September 2, 2021
Building Products
Builders FirstSource, Inc. has acquired California TrusFrame, LLC from TriWest Capital Partners for an enterprise value of US$179.5 million. California TrusFrame, a manufacturer of prefabricated roof trusses, floor trusses and wall panels based in Murrieta, California with four manufacturing facilities, will integrate into Builders FirstSource and its leadership (including CEO Shawn Overholtzer) will join the company.

ANSYS Acquires Assets of DfR Solutions
May 1, 2019
Software
ANSYS acquired substantially all assets of DfR Solutions, the developer of Sherlock automated electronics reliability analysis software, to integrate electronics reliability capabilities into its multiphysics simulation portfolio. The deal is intended to enable designers to analyze electronics failure earlier in the design cycle and extend ANSYS’ electronic simulation offerings to include reliability and durability analyses for industries such as automotive, aerospace and medical devices.
